The paper analyses the results of a survey of 37 Russian biosphere reserves using questionnaires concerning the presence of alien species of mammals, their pathways of penetration, and their impacts on protected ecosystems. The penetration of alien mammals into terrestrial ecosystems of Russia is extensive, both in places with maximum human environmental impact (inhabited areas and agricultural lands) and in biosphere reserves with minimal human impact. There are 62 mammal species registered as alien in Russian ecosystems and they account for 22% of the terrestrial mammal fauna of Russia. The percentage of alien species in biosphere reserves is 32.6% at most. In most regions, Castor fiber, Ondatra zibethicus, Nyctereutes procyonoides, Canis familiaris, Neovison vison and Sus scrofa are very dangerous, and both Castor fiber and Sus scrofa can have environment-forming impacts.

We assessed the diversity of rodent communities in the deserts of Russia, Kazakhstan, and Central Asia using geographic information system technology. There are 66 species of rodents, belonging to eight faunistic complexes, inhabiting this area. We discuss the geographical changes occurring in taxonomic and zoogeographic diversity at both species and community levels. Communities of gerbils and jerboas dominate in the Turan Desert region (66% of the area). Steppe communities of susliks penetrate the deserts from the north. Farming in deserts causes the replacement of native rodent communities with mouse communities or completely eradicates rodents in their main habitats.
